Output 6638b990e3adcb5841394d65ea2b6c25f91cfd904c804f927eed3ed0b6de33bd:1

value
1091512
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2babc1e54fcfd106d6e9b89694101bbc2b14f042 OP_EQUALVERIFY OP_CHECKSIG
address
14yupARTLUGwub78gGjnBJK9mAA2gAymKB
transaction
6638b990e3adcb5841394d65ea2b6c25f91cfd904c804f927eed3ed0b6de33bd
spent
true